CHANGE OF SCHEDULE.
Over the B. & B. and Seahea'rf Air
Line.
No. 1, to Jacksonville and points
south, leaves 6 a. m.
No. 3, to Savannah and points north,
leaves 11 a. m.
No. 6, to Jacksonville and points
south, leaves 3:30 p. m.
No. 7, to Savannah and points north,
leaves 8:60 p. m.
No. 2, from Savannah and points
north arrives 7:56 a. m.
No. 4. from Jacksonville and points
south, arrives 12:41 p. m.
No. 8, from Savannah and points
north, arrives 6:20 p. m.
No. 8. from Jacksonville and points
south, arrives 10:45 p. m.

: Views Vfoles.
Mrs. S. E. Cargyle continues ser
iously ill.
• * *
I Miss Maud Haywood, of Savannah,
is visiting Mrs. C. B. Lloyd.
• • •
Mr3. J. B. Wright and Miss Bessie
Fox will spend today In the city.
• • •
Mrs. Thomas Fuller will entertain
the Acacia club tomorrow afternoon.
• * •
Mrs. Troy Beatty and children, of
Amens, are guests of Mrs. ,1. J. Perry.
• • •
Misses Ethel and Ker/zle Conoley
have returned from a pleasant trip to
Atlanta.
Mrs. Noyes, of Savannah. is the
guest of Mrs. D. Watson Winn on
St. Simon.
• • •
Mrs. James Floyd, of Savannah. ;s
the guest of Mrs. John Foster at St.
Simon Mills.
Miss Harfiy, who has been the guest
of Miss Daisy Goldsmith, will leave
for her home this week.
* * *
Mrs. W. F. Parser and children
leave tomorrow [or Brooklyn where
they will spend the summer.
• *
Col. J. L. Jacobi, manager of the
Cumberland island 'note! left last
last night on a business trip to Char
leston. Macon and other cities.
• • •
Today at 1 o'clock the Ladies’ Aid
Society, of St. Marks church will
serve lunch in the Wright building
on Monk and Newscast le streets.
This will be an excellent opportunity
for business men and the pubic gen
erally to g>lt an elegant lunch down
town. In Cue afternoon ire cream and
cake will be semi I oml fancy arti
cles sold. All ae cordially invited to
attend.
